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Brilliant-thighed poison frog | Chibchan water mouse |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Amphibia (Amphibians)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Anura (Frogs & Toads) | Rodentia (Rodents) |
| Family | Aromobatidae | Cricetidae |
| Genus | Allobates | Chibchanomys |
| Species | Allobates femoralis | Chibchanomys orcesi |
Evolutionary Relationship
Brilliant-thighed poison frog and Chibchan water mouse share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
